A Norwich hotel has scooped a top award in a national competition – which judges the best toilets around the country.
The Maids Head Hotel won the Best English Hotel Loo in the Loo of the Year Awards 2015, as well as a top platinum grading and an Attendant of the Year Award for cleanliness.
It comes after the hotel finished a year-long project costing £140,000 to refurbish all public toilets in the historic building.
Christine Malcolm, hotel general manager, said: 'We are very proud of our refurbished toilets.
'It is fantastic to have received this endorsement of their quality, with a national English Loo of the Year Award.
'I am particularly pleased for our hard-working housekeeping team, led by Mandy Ames and specifically Erwin Mullari, who has overall responsibility for keeping the toilets looking at their best.'
The Loo of the Year Awards have been assessing the country's toilets since 1987.
